Background on Zinc

Zinc builds research-rich, mission-focused start-ups that respond to big societal challenges. Our start-ups create new products and services intended to improve the health of people and planet.

Start-ups are created through our venture-builder programme, which brings together people from diverse communities and professional backgrounds in a full-time programme of content, support and development here in London. Founders receive six months of intensive support and have a chance both to meet an extraordinary co-founder within their cohort, and to receive investment in their new venture once they incorporate.

At the end of the six-month venture-builder programme, Zinc invests in new companies created during that programme, who stay with us for ‘Accelerate’ - a further six months of personal and business development support with a focus on understanding user needs, developing their product and defining their value proposition.

As well as supporting founders within any given venture-builder and Accelerate cohort, we provide ongoing support to our portfolio of existing companies, created during previous Zinc venture-builders.

Research is central to our work. Our growing in-house Research & Development (R&D) team helps founders to connect with researchers and use existing research, as well as to design and implement high-quality research of their own. Away from the venture-builder, we promote work at the intersections of research and innovation through things like our delivery of the UKRI Healthy Ageing Catalyst Awards, by running independent research and development programmes, and by creating new opportunities (including these Internships) for researchers to explore the world of early-stage innovation.
